What Is the Cost of Living Near Las Vegas?

Understanding the cost of living near Las Vegas is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at TOURAcademy.
Las Vegas'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.8 (1.8% more expensive than US average; 0.3% less than NV average). Major entertainment/tourism hub, housing costs have risen, can be near US avg. RTC trans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from TOURAcademy,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,800+ A significant portion of TOURAcademy sal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 (High AC use)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$65 (RTC mon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,665 - $4,225+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
